More than 40 school girls take part in sports taster day
More than 40 girls have taken part in a sports taster day. The event, led by Sport Pembrokeshire, took place at Ysgol Bro Gwaun on July 7 and offered a range of activities including gymnastics, archery, taekwondo and zorb balling. There was also cricket, fitness sessions, netball, hockey and rowing. The day was supported by community clubs and providers, with help from the school's young ambassadors. Dan Bellis from Sport Pembrokeshire said: "We had a fantastic fun-filled morning of activities and a great time was had by all. "A big thanks to all the girls for their energy, effort and enthusiasm and to all the deliverers and local providers for supporting this event." He said it was especially rewarding to hear that even those who don't usually enjoy sport found the day fun. Water and fruit were donated by Princes Gate and Morrisons, and additional goodies by local businesses.

Pembrokeshire ALN pupils given chance to try new sports
The event was sponsored by Valero and supported by young ambassadors (Image: Pembrokeshire County Council) Pupils with additional learning needs have been given the opportunity to try new sports in a supportive environment. Two ALN multisport community events, organised by Sport Pembrokeshire, took place in June, offering taster sessions delivered by local clubs and organisations. Elgan Vittle of Sport Pembrokeshire said: "The aim of the events is to promote confidence, social interaction, and physical wellbeing, while encouraging participants to explore new activities in a safe and welcoming environment. "By working closely with schools and community partners, we strive to ensure that every young person—regardless of ability—has access to positive, meaningful sporting experiences that celebrate participation, effort, and fun." Schools in attendance included Tenby Primary, Monkton, and Portfield in the south, and Glannau Gwaun, Waldo Williams, Penrhyn Dewi, and Johnston in the north. Mr Vittle said: "The feedback was fantastic from all the schools and pupils including the staff really had a great time and we're hoping that quite a few young people will now join some local clubs as a direct result of this event." The events were sponsored by Valero, with support from young ambassadors from Ysgol Harri Tudur and Ysgol Bro Gwaun.

Pembrokeshire pupils enjoy special sports event
Pupils took part in various sports (Image: Pembrokeshire County Council) More than 60 pupils enjoyed trying out different sports at a special Sport Pembrokeshire event this month. The event, held at Ysgol Glannau Gwaun on June 11, had 65 pupils from Years 4, 5, and 6 as well as the ALN unit participating. Sharon Osborne from Ysgol Glannau Gwaun said: "Thanks to Sport Pembrokeshire for organising a fantastic morning of activities for our pupils. "They all thoroughly enjoyed themselves." Dan Bellis of Sport Pembrokeshire added: "A big thanks to Fishguard & Goodwick Hockey Club, Fishguard and Goodwick Rugby Club, and the Young Ambassadors from Ysgol Bro Gwaun for putting on a fabulous morning of activities in glorious sunshine. "A big well done to all the pupils from Ysgol Glannau Gwaun for their effort and enthusiasm throughout the morning."
